基于微信小程序的自习室预约系统(源代码)

上传者: xy520chxu | 上传时间: 2026-03-03 22:47:29 | 文件大小: 13.32MB | 文件类型: RAR
在当今数字化时代背景下,微信小程序作为一款无需下载安装即可使用的应用,因其便捷性和高效性被广泛应用于各行各业。基于微信小程序开发的自习室预约系统,正是结合移动互联网技术与日常学习需求的产物。此类系统主要面向高校学生、图书馆用户或独立自习室运营者,通过提供线上预约服务,优化了自习室的使用效率,解决了传统人工预约方式的种种不便。 该系统的核心功能包括用户注册登录、座位预约与管理、预约时间设定、自习室环境信息展示等。用户可以通过微信小程序快速注册账号,并通过简单的操作完成自习室的座位预约。系统可以设定不同的预约时间段,允许用户根据自己的学习计划进行选择。同时,通过自习室环境信息的展示,用户可以了解到自习室的设施情况、开放时间等重要信息,从而做出更好的预约决策。 系统后台管理功能则主要服务于自习室的管理员,包括用户管理、座位管理、预约数据统计等。管理员可以通过管理端对自习室座位进行增删改查,对用户的预约行为进行审核和管理。此外,系统还可以根据用户的预约情况和自习室使用情况生成各种统计数据和报告,帮助管理员更好地掌握自习室的运营状态。 在技术实现方面,微信小程序主要使用了微信官方提供的开发框架和API接口,前端开发多采用WXML(微信标记语言)、WXSS(微信样式表)以及JavaScript,后端则可能使用云开发服务或自建服务器,搭配数据库如MySQL、MongoDB等来存储数据。系统的稳定性和用户体验是开发过程中的重点考虑因素,因此开发团队会在代码编写过程中注重代码的优化与测试,确保系统在高并发情况下的稳定运行。 此外,针对用户隐私安全问题,开发者需严格按照相关法律法规,对用户的个人信息进行保护。在用户注册登录环节,系统应当采取加密存储用户数据,并对用户数据的访问权限进行严格控制,确保用户信息的安全。同时,在系统设计中也需要考虑到用户使用习惯和体验,提供简洁直观的操作界面,以提升用户的使用满意度。 基于微信小程序的自习室预约系统通过技术手段有效改善了学习资源的分配和管理效率,为广大用户提供了一个便捷、高效的学习环境。该系统不仅提高了自习室的使用率,也为用户创造了更好的学习体验,是现代教育信息化管理的重要工具。

文件下载

资源详情

[{"title":"( 1168 个子文件 13.32MB ) 基于微信小程序的自习室预约系统(源代码)","children":[{"title":"main.css.bak <span style='color:#111;'> 62.66KB </span>","children":null,"spread":false},{"title":"update-password.vue.bak <span style='color:#111;'> 3.16KB </span>","children":null,"spread":false},{"title":"IndexMain.vue.bak <span style='color:#111;'> 2.12KB </span>","children":null,"spread":false},{"title":"IndexAsideStatic.vue.bak <span style='color:#111;'> 1.99KB </span>","children":null,"spread":false},{"title":"BreadCrumbs.vue.bak <span style='color:#111;'> 1.95KB </span>","children":null,"spread":false},{"title":"IndexHeader.vue.bak <span style='color:#111;'> 1.58KB </span>","children":null,"spread":false},{"title":"3-build.bat <span style='color:#111;'> 15B </span>","children":null,"spread":false},{"title":"2-run.bat <span style='color:#111;'> 14B </span>","children":null,"spread":false},{"title":"1-install.bat <span style='color:#111;'> 12B </span>","children":null,"spread":false},{"title":".classpath <span style='color:#111;'> 1.32KB </span>","children":null,"spread":false},{"title":"org.eclipse.wst.common.component <span style='color:#111;'> 689B </span>","children":null,"spread":false},{"title":"org.eclipse.wst.jsdt.ui.superType.container <span style='color:#111;'> 49B </span>","children":null,"spread":false},{"title":"app.f036c7e3.css <span style='color:#111;'> 262.41KB </span>","children":null,"spread":false},{"title":"bootstrap.css <span style='color:#111;'> 142.66KB </span>","children":null,"spread":false},{"title":"bootstrap.min.css <span style='color:#111;'> 118.42KB </span>","children":null,"spread":false},{"title":"index.2d26d90a.css <span style='color:#111;'> 79.23KB </span>","children":null,"spread":false},{"title":"icon.css <span style='color:#111;'> 69.68KB </span>","children":null,"spread":false},{"title":"main.css <span style='color:#111;'> 63.84KB </span>","children":null,"spread":false},{"title":"chunk-vendors.1f0a25b2.css <span style='color:#111;'> 36.57KB </span>","children":null,"spread":false},{"title":"global-restaurant.css <span style='color:#111;'> 6.71KB </span>","children":null,"spread":false},{"title":"mescroll-uni.css <span style='color:#111;'> 3.88KB </span>","children":null,"spread":false},{"title":"animation.css <span style='color:#111;'> 2.53KB </span>","children":null,"spread":false},{"title":"canvas-bg-1.css <span style='color:#111;'> 391B </span>","children":null,"spread":false},{"title":"canvas-bg-2.css <span style='color:#111;'> 83B </span>","children":null,"spread":false},{"title":"canvas-bg-3.css <span style='color:#111;'> 61B </span>","children":null,"spread":false},{"title":"app或者微信小程序开发文档.docx <span style='color:#111;'> 13.39KB </span>","children":null,"spread":false},{"title":"glyphicons-halflings-regular.eot <span style='color:#111;'> 19.66KB </span>","children":null,"spread":false},{"title":".gitignore <span style='color:#111;'> 10B </span>","children":null,"spread":false},{"title":"index.html <span style='color:#111;'> 1.01KB </span>","children":null,"spread":false},{"title":"index.html <span style='color:#111;'> 924B </span>","children":null,"spread":false},{"title":"index.html <span style='color:#111;'> 552B </span>","children":null,"spread":false},{"title":"favicon.ico <span style='color:#111;'> 4.19KB </span>","children":null,"spread":false},{"title":"favicon.ico <span style='color:#111;'> 4.19KB </span>","children":null,"spread":false},{"title":"JieshuxuexiController.java <span style='color:#111;'> 10.67KB </span>","children":null,"spread":false},{"title":"CommonController.java <span style='color:#111;'> 9.06KB </span>","children":null,"spread":false},{"title":"YonghuController.java <span style='color:#111;'> 8.68KB </span>","children":null,"spread":false},{"title":"ZixishiController.java <span style='color:#111;'> 7.60K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ueController.java <span style='color:#111;'> 7.27KB </span>","children":null,"spread":false},{"title":"YijianfankuiController.java <span style='color:#111;'> 7.26K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ueEntity.java <span style='color:#111;'> 6.60KB </span>","children":null,"spread":false},{"title":"NewsController.java <span style='color:#111;'> 6.08KB </span>","children":null,"spread":false},{"title":"JieshuxuexiEntity.java <span style='color:#111;'> 5.67K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ueModel.java <span style='color:#111;'> 5.47K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ueVO.java <span style='color:#111;'> 5.38KB </span>","children":null,"spread":false},{"title":"UserController.java <span style='color:#111;'> 5.18KB </span>","children":null,"spread":false},{"title":"MPUtil.java <span style='color:#111;'> 5.17KB </span>","children":null,"spread":false},{"title":"ZixishiEntity.java <span style='color:#111;'> 4.84KB </span>","children":null,"spread":false},{"title":"YijianfankuiEntity.java <span style='color:#111;'> 4.64KB </span>","children":null,"spread":false},{"title":"JieshuxuexiModel.java <span style='color:#111;'> 4.49KB </span>","children":null,"spread":false},{"title":"JieshuxuexiVO.java <span style='color:#111;'> 4.39KB </span>","children":null,"spread":false},{"title":"ZixishiModel.java <span style='color:#111;'> 3.62KB </span>","children":null,"spread":false},{"title":"BaiduUtil.java <span style='color:#111;'> 3.60KB </span>","children":null,"spread":false},{"title":"ZixishiVO.java <span style='color:#111;'> 3.53KB </span>","children":null,"spread":false},{"title":"YijianfankuiModel.java <span style='color:#111;'> 3.41KB </span>","children":null,"spread":false},{"title":"YonghuEntity.java <span style='color:#111;'> 3.35KB </span>","children":null,"spread":false},{"title":"YijianfankuiVO.java <span style='color:#111;'> 3.32KB </span>","children":null,"spread":false},{"title":"FileController.java <span style='color:#111;'> 3.21KB </span>","children":null,"spread":false},{"title":"ConfigController.java <span style='color:#111;'> 3.02KB </span>","children":null,"spread":false},{"title":"AuthorizationInterceptor.java <span style='color:#111;'> 2.95KB </span>","children":null,"spread":false},{"title":"NewsEntity.java <span style='color:#111;'> 2.70KB </span>","children":null,"spread":false},{"title":"Query.java <span style='color:#111;'> 2.60KB </span>","children":null,"spread":false},{"title":"JieshuxuexiServiceImpl.java <span style='color:#111;'> 2.51KB </span>","children":null,"spread":false},{"title":"TokenServiceImpl.java <span style='color:#111;'> 2.41KB </span>","children":null,"spread":false},{"title":"CommonUtil.java <span style='color:#111;'> 2.18KB </span>","children":null,"spread":false},{"title":"TokenEntity.java <span style='color:#111;'> 2.14KB </span>","children":null,"spread":false},{"title":"YonghuModel.java <span style='color:#111;'> 2.07KB </span>","children":null,"spread":false},{"title":"YonghuVO.java <span style='color:#111;'> 1.98K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ueServiceImpl.java <span style='color:#111;'> 1.94KB </span>","children":null,"spread":false},{"title":"YijianfankuiServiceImpl.java <span style='color:#111;'> 1.94KB </span>","children":null,"spread":false},{"title":"PageUtils.java <span style='color:#111;'> 1.92KB </span>","children":null,"spread":false},{"title":"ZixishiServiceImpl.java <span style='color:#111;'> 1.83KB </span>","children":null,"spread":false},{"title":"YonghuServiceImpl.java <span style='color:#111;'> 1.80KB </span>","children":null,"spread":false},{"title":"NewsServiceImpl.java <span style='color:#111;'> 1.76KB </span>","children":null,"spread":false},{"title":"NewsModel.java <span style='color:#111;'> 1.48KB </span>","children":null,"spread":false},{"title":"CommonServiceImpl.java <span style='color:#111;'> 1.41KB </span>","children":null,"spread":false},{"title":"JieshuxuexiDao.java <span style='color:#111;'> 1.40KB </span>","children":null,"spread":false},{"title":"NewsVO.java <span style='color:#111;'> 1.38KB </span>","children":null,"spread":false},{"title":"UserServiceImpl.java <span style='color:#111;'> 1.34KB </span>","children":null,"spread":false},{"title":"JieshuxuexiService.java <span style='color:#111;'> 1.33KB </span>","children":null,"spread":false},{"title":"UserEntity.java <span style='color:#111;'> 1.22KB </span>","children":null,"spread":false},{"title":"SpringContextUtils.java <span style='color:#111;'> 1.10KB </span>","children":null,"spread":false},{"title":"ValidatorUtils.java <span style='color:#111;'> 1.08KB </span>","children":null,"spread":false},{"title":"SQLFilter.java <span style='color:#111;'> 1.04K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ueService.java <span style='color:#111;'> 1.02KB </span>","children":null,"spread":false},{"title":"YijianfankuiService.java <span style='color:#111;'> 1.02KB </span>","children":null,"spread":false},{"title":"ZixishiyuyueDao.java <span style='color:#111;'> 1.01KB </span>","children":null,"spread":false},{"title":"YijianfankuiDao.java <span style='color:#111;'> 1.00KB </span>","children":null,"spread":false},{"title":"HttpClientUtils.java <span style='color:#111;'> 1013B </span>","children":null,"spread":false},{"title":"ZixishiService.java <span style='color:#111;'> 969B </span>","children":null,"spread":false},{"title":"YonghuService.java <span style='color:#111;'> 952B </span>","children":null,"spread":false},{"title":"ZixishiDao.java <span style='color:#111;'> 951B </span>","children":null,"spread":false},{"title":"ZixishiyuyueView.java <span style='color:#111;'> 949B </span>","children":null,"spread":false},{"title":"YijianfankuiView.java <span style='color:#111;'> 946B </span>","children":null,"spread":false},{"title":"JieshuxuexiView.java <span style='color:#111;'> 937B </span>","children":null,"spread":false},{"title":"YonghuDao.java <span style='color:#111;'> 933B </span>","children":null,"spread":false},{"title":"NewsService.java <span style='color:#111;'> 930B </span>","children":null,"spread":false},{"title":"NewsDao.java <span style='color:#111;'> 909B </span>","children":null,"spread":false},{"title":"ZixishiView.java <span style='color:#111;'> 898B </span>","children":null,"spread":false},{"title":"ConfigServiceImpl.java <span style='color:#111;'> 895B </span>","children":null,"spread":false},{"title":"YonghuView.java <span style='color:#111;'> 886B </span>","children":null,"spread":false},{"title":"......","children":null,"spread":false},{"title":"<span style='color:steelblue;'>文件过多,未全部展示</span>","children":null,"spread":false}],"spread":true}]

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明